h1   { font-size: 200%; color: #ddf; background: #128; 
       text-align: center; padding-top: 0.5em; padding-bottom: 0.5em; }
h2   { font-size: 150%; color: #248; background: #cfd; margin-top: 2em; padding:0.3em; }
h3   { font-size: 110%; color: #162; margin-top: 2em; }
h4   { font-size: 105%; color: #128; margin-left: 2%; }
p    { margin-left: 3%; margin-right: 3%; }
.code {  border: 1px solid black; background: #eef; padding: 0.3em; margin-left: 5%; margin-right: 10%; color: #e33; font-family: monospace;font-size: 110%; }
li { margin-left: 3%; margin-bottom: 1ex; }
tt { color: #e33; }
.warn { margin-left: 4%; margin-right: 4%; color: #f11; background: #fee; 
        padding: 0.3em; border: 1px solid; }
.note { margin-left: 4%; margin-right: 4%; color: #000; background: #eef; 
        padding: 0.3em; border: 1px solid; }
.ex { border: 1px solid black; background: #eef; padding: 0.3em; margin: 1em; }
